1. Beatoven.ai: The Best for Narrative Content & Podcasts
In case your video content focuses significantly on the progress of the story, be it a travel log or an elaborate documentary essay, Beatoven.ai is a perfect choice for generating music based on the storytelling process itself.
- How it works: Rather than simply providing a textual prompt, this service requests that you select the genre you need, input the exact video length, and provide a series of various emotion tags (e.g., Sad ➔ Calm ➔ Tense).
- The Creator Advantage: The AI splits your timeline into emotional segments and composes an evolving instrumental score that shifts instruments exactly when your video changes tone. Every track downloaded delivers a Track ID certificate to instantly resolve any automated social media copyright claims.
2. SOUNDRAW: The Ultimate Choice for Control Freaks
Most AI music engines operate like a lottery: you type a prompt and hope you like the static file it generates. SOUNDRAW breaks this mold by giving you full control over the composition.
- The Free Deal: Select a baseline mood, speed, and instrumentation. The AI generates an arrangement instantly.
- Watermark & Resolution: It allows access to the DAW (Digital Audio Workstation) Mixer automatically. You have the option to turn down the level of the drums if you like the tune but find the sound of the drums is too loud for your voiceover sequence. This can be done manually by selecting particular beats and without any knowledge of music.

Audio Mixing Checklist to Ensure Perfect Sound
To ensure that the background sound generated by the AI does not overshadow the vocals in your content, adhere to the following audio mixing guidelines after production:
1. The Vocal Anchor (Gain Staging)
- Load the voice-over file to your editing timeline. Make sure that the peak level of the vocal volume meter ranges from -6 dB to -3 dB. The voice is the key component in your edit and has to be the basis of everything else.
2. Isolate the AI Instrumental Base
- Generate your AI score matching the exact length of your clip. Place it on the track below your vocal file and lower the track's default level to a baseline of -18dB to -22dB. Background music should be felt, not actively noticed.
3. Clear a Frequency Pocket (EQ Split)
- This is because natural human speech tends to compete with other instrumental frequencies such as that of the acoustic guitar, synths, and pianos in the middle range spectrum (approximately 1kHz to 3kHz). Add parametric equalization to your AI track and place a wide and subtle 3dB cut in the 1kHz to 2.5kHz area.
4. Apply Dynamic Side-Chain Ducking
- Set up a compressor node on your music track and route your vocal track as the side-chain input trigger. Set the threshold to a fast attack time. This setup automatically lowers the music volume whenever you speak, and subtly swells the music volume back up during pauses between sentences.

A standard export bundles all elements into a single file. A STEM Download splits the track into separate independent layers—separating the drum beats, the synthesizer pads, the bass guitar line, and the melodic keys. Stacking these split elements inside your editor timeline provides elite control: you can easily drop out loud drum patterns entirely during a voiceover block, and bring them back full force when a massive visual transition occurs.
